Thus before you can prevent fungal infection, it is important that you know what is and kinds of fungal infection are there. Fungal infection is caused by fungus (singular), fungi (plural). Their growth on human skin, hair or nails is exceptional because here they obtain sustenance from keratin. This protein is the base for hair, nails mostly but also for skin and is the source from where the fungus obtains the required nutrients.

Type of Fungal Infections
The commonest mistake done by all is taking fungal infection to be one skin infection. On the contrary it is a skin aliment which is further divided into different kinds of fungal infections which includes;
1)Candidacies or Yeast Infection
2)Tinea Versicolor
3)Ringworm Infection further divided into - Jock itch, Athlete's foot, Scalp ringworm, Nail ringworm and Body ringworm
Enlisting Few Ways for Preventing Fungal Infections
1)Wear flip flops, slippers etc to cover the feet as walking bare foot can lead to contracting fungal infections. So when in locker rooms, gyms, around swimming pools or any other such place never walk bare foot, it helps in preventing fungal infection.
2)After bathing or a shower dry your body completely, as moisture can lead to fungal infection.
3)For preventing fungal infection follow this as a rule - personal items such as razors, toothbrush, towel, shaving brush should never be shared with anyone.
4)Washing hands before having something with good antifungal soap helps in preventing fungal infection. But it should also be done after touch any dirty surfaces.
5)Dont touch face or scratch skin with unclean hands as they can lead to fungal infection.
6)Have a nutritious diet as it will help build your immunity, thus assisting in preventing fungal infection.
7)Water is elixir to life and it has strong capacity to prevent fungal infection. Approximately 8 11 glasses a day will not only detoxify your body but also help in preventing fungal infection.
